WebHow do opportunity zones work? Developers who invest in economically distressed communities through the program are given three tax incentives: temporary deferral, step-up in basis, and permanent exclusion of capital gains. With temporary deferral, investors can defer tax on prior capital gains reinvested in a Qualified Opportunity Zone. WebJul 2, 2024 · How does the Opportunity Zone program work? The program consists of two parts. The first asked governors to identify up to 25 percent of their low-income census tracts for certification by the U.S. Treasury Department as Opportunity Zones. These designations last ten years and cannot be changed. WebAn Opportunity Zone is a community nominated by the state and certified by the Treasury Department as qualifying for this program. WebSep 2, 2024 · Opportunity zone designations will expire on December 31, 2028. How Do Opportunity Zones Work? OZs permit investors to invest in businesses operating within its borders and to receive several tax incentives. To reap the tax benefits, the opportunity zone must be qualified. You invest in an OZ through a qualified opportunity fund (QOF).
